Indian Oil Corporation Limited invites bids for Custom Bid for Services - NonComprehensive Annual Maintenance Contract of Terminal Automation System TAS for a period of 2 Years at Kandla Foreshore Terminal in KACHCHH, GUJARAT. Quantity: 1. Submission Deadline: 27-02-2025 13: 00: 00. Submit your proposal before the deadline.
